Tests, training, and exercises are critical to ensuring that:

  • Vital systems work.
  • Personnel have the skills and knowledge they need to implement the COOP, if necessary.
  • The plan works as intended.

This lesson will cover the reasons to test, train, and exercise. The lesson will also cover the types of tests, training, and exercises that are commonly used in COOP planning.
